Default Water leak

Hi all i have a 2001 wrx and have noticed a burning coolant smell for past few weeks. I noticed today that there is a leak coming from down below the throttle body. I cant see the pipe that is leaking all i can see is it dripping onto the top of the engine. Anyone know what pipe it could be or have also had this problem. Thanks

Coolant is run through the throttle body to prevent it icing up in extreme weather. It is only rubber hose so conceivable that it has perished. Plenty of people just re-route the pipework to take out that run - I've done it without any running issues.
